Output 590cc1a25396edc2096f00c316a5dfefe2e6c57d463b452fd9bb5bf757b41eec:1

value
1415600
script pubkey
OP_0 OP_PUSHBYTES_20 ef621cbc5eb60406ef38f6da6c89fc5a27928e13
address
ltc1qaa3pe0z7kczqdmec7mdxez0utgne9rsnqff327
transaction
590cc1a25396edc2096f00c316a5dfefe2e6c57d463b452fd9bb5bf757b41eec
spent
true